7 month old Atascadero baby tests positive for cocaine

A 7-month-old Atascadero boy has been placed into protective custody, after the baby's urine tested positive for cocaine.

The boy's father, 26-year-old Billy Lee Remick, Junior, was arrested last Friday by San Luis Obispo County sheriff's deputies on charges of child cruelty and possession of a controlled substance.

Deputies searched Remick's apartment last week following up on a marijuana investigation. The sheriff's department says Remick had attempted to illegally ship 559 grams of marijuana to a location in New York state a week earlier.

The sheriff's department says that's when they found the boy in a crib next to a nightstand with several loose pills, including illegal narcotics.

A sample of the boys urine was then taken for testing and the baby was turned over to Child Welfare Services.
